Output 3c3f654d7d6736f21063ce21db43cd17bea85e08e0a17766adafeb48805a829a:44

value
29538
script pubkey
OP_0 OP_PUSHBYTES_20 521dd7882d7f7fa018dc30f6905240432726541b
address
bc1q2gwa0zpd0al6qxxuxrmfq5jqgvnjv4qm4t8w0u
transaction
3c3f654d7d6736f21063ce21db43cd17bea85e08e0a17766adafeb48805a829a
spent
true